Being Desi in America aims to increase cultural awareness and humility by highlighting the personal and professional experiences of those from South Asian descent. This will be a platform for South Asians to discuss the influence of their culture on their lives in America. We hope to host a multitude of guests, ranging from college students and community members to influencers and professionals in order to showcase a variety of individual experiences.
